Five treatment centers near Ball Ground currently report accepting Optum plans, but your specific plan may have different in-network or out-of-network rules depending on your policy type and employer. Confirm which facilities participate with your plan before calling—you can ask Optum directly or check your benefits paperwork.
Optum administers plans for different employers and carriers, each with its own addiction-treatment benefits and approval process. Before contacting a program, have your member ID and plan documents ready so staff can verify what your coverage includes.
If the center you prefer is not in Optum's network in Ball Ground, some plans allow out-of-network claims with higher out-of-pocket costs, while others require in-network treatment to cover the cost—your plan documents or a call to Optum will clarify which applies to you. Out-of-network treatment sometimes requires pre-authorization to be covered at all.
Programs near Ball Ground can tell you their wait times and which Optum plans they work with most, but only your plan administrator can confirm final approval and your exact benefits. Asking both the center and Optum removes guesswork and usually speeds up admission.
Before calling a treatment program, have your Optum member ID and policy details ready—the facility will need them to check whether you're in-network for their level of care. Out-of-network treatment is still an option if a program better fits your needs, though you may pay more out of pocket; ask the facility to run a benefits verification so you understand the cost difference upfront. Call the member services number on the back of your Optum card and ask about in-network addiction treatment providers near Ball Ground, or request a detailed benefits explanation in writing that includes deductibles, copays, and any pre-authorization requirements before treatment begins.
In-network providers typically cost you less out of pocket than out-of-network ones, but your actual cost depends on your specific plan—deductibles, copays, and coinsurance all differ by policy, so contact Optum directly to understand your plan's terms.
Pre-authorization is approval from your insurance company before treatment starts; most facilities in the Ball Ground area handle requesting it on your behalf once you're admitted, but calling Optum ahead of time lets you know if it's required for your plan.
